@todaygold I want simplicity and i don't care about the domain name. Yes, it's a sub-domain and i want to give a trial to this.
Seriously ?
You want to sell domain names so you should care about the domain name. Why would people take you seriously otherwise.
The domain name is also important for SEO and you don't want to build a home on a domain that you do not control. It could be sunsetted one day, Centralnic-mode :)

When I saw all those links in the middle of the page, I thought that it looked like a parked page. If I stumbled on your site while surfing the Internet, I would close the window immediately. There are very little graphics. The human touch is missing.
I know it's a development exercise but I would not advise spending too much time on it.
In fact domain portfolios are generally useless. I know, because I built one too :lookaround:
If somebody wants a domain that you own, they will find you. They will either type the domain or use whois. Unless you redirect the domains to your site, nobody will visit it.

People don't browse for domain names, except maybe on very large platforms like Sedo or Buydomains because there is choice and they can search for certain keywords/patterns.

Concentrate on the inventory, not the front window. Good luck.

When it comes to creating a website.... when you are done.. there is one question you need to ask yourself.

Would YOU feel comfortable handing over $1000 or whatever to this business.?


If you can't answer yes to that then you need to keep working on the site until you can say YES.... then after that you ask other people for their input on the site.

In all honesty, if I went over to the site and I saw it on a free weebly platform....I would be very hesitant to spend any money there. Even if the site looked good... the weebly domain would be an immediate red flag for me.

Think about it this way...you are a domain market place. You are selling people domain names due to their brand ability or relevance to their business....If I was a customer on your site I would immediately think that you don't believe in what you selling because you yourself do not see the value in having a domain name for your own business.

It's like walking into a BWM dealership.. and the sales people are telling u what an awesome car it is and that the build quality is great and safety is awesome and so is the performance and blah blah blah blah....basically telling u that there is no better car on the planet...but then u glance over to the staff parking area and you see that all of them drive Mercedes Benz as their personal vehicles...
